For decades, twins have intrigued scientists and researchers with their genetic similarities and differences Identical twins, also known as monozygotic twins, are born from a single fertilized egg that splits into two embryos As a result, these twins share nearly identical genetic material, making them ideal subjects for studying the influence of genetics on various traits and characteristics.

On the other hand, fraternal twins, or dizygotic twins, develop from two separate eggs fertilized by two different sperm As a result, they share about 50% of their genetic material, similar to any other sibling born at different times Despite this, fraternal twins can still exhibit remarkable similarities in their DNA, leading to the question of how much genetics truly influences our physical appearance and personality traits.

One of the most common reasons twins opt for DNA testing is to determine their zygosity, or whether they are identical or fraternal twins While physical appearance can sometimes provide clues to their zygosity, DNA testing offers a more comprehensive and accurate assessment of their genetic similarities By comparing their DNA profiles, twins can definitively ascertain whether they are monozygotic or dizygotic twins, settling a long-standing curiosity about their shared genetic heritage.

For twins separated at birth or adopted into different families, DNA testing offers a means of reuniting and establishing biological connections By submitting their DNA samples to ancestry databases, twins separated at birth can potentially find each other and reunite after years of separation DNA testing has played a crucial role in reuniting long-lost twins and uncovering the truth about their shared genetic bonds.
